This is the first image from my series on Jali. Jali is a fascinating subject, not merely because of the intricate patterns and designs to be found in Jali work, but to me it has been a symbol of a barrier. When the barrier is beautiful, does it take away the harshness of the purpose itself ? ( Pune, 2017)
